The Quillforge build fleet syncs clocks centrally, but agents can drift by up to two seconds between sync intervals. If your plugin compares timestamps produced on different agents—for cache invalidation, artifact ordering, or signing—you must tolerate that skew or use the coordinator's monotonic sequence numbers instead. Never fail a build on a small negative time delta. Guidance on acceptable tolerances and the sequence-number API is maintained on the internal page linked below.

dashboard of tahop-fahof = https://harbor.tolvaqnet.example/secrets/merge_requests/board/issue/merge_requests/pipeline/secrets/ecb30ed86a55c001a77f6cb9

**Alert: ReconDrift-High**

Fires when the nightly inventory reconciliation job on Stockhaven diverges more than 0.5% between warehouse counts and ledger totals. Usually caused by a stalled sync worker, not real shrinkage. Do not restart the job blindly; check the worker queue first. Escalate to the Ledger team if drift persists past two runs. Triage steps are on the internal page below.

runbook for badug-kadup: https://confluence.zemvarlabs.internal/projects/browse/display/projects/bd1b

## Runbook: Invoice PDF Failures (Paperquill)

If Paperquill fails to render invoice PDFs, customers see a blank download. First check the render worker queue; a backlog over 200 jobs means the font cache likely needs a flush. Restarting workers is safe — jobs are idempotent. Do not re-issue invoices manually. Full triage steps and escalation order are on the internal page below.

operations page: https://jira.qorvelsys.internal/browse/pages/browse/pages